ANNAPOLIS, MD (NBC/CBS) – Authorities say several people have been shot at the Capital Gazette newspaper office in Annapolis, Maryland according to local news outlets.
Reports from the Gazette Staff to CBS Baltimore indicate as many as four of those people may be dead.
Authorities responded to a report of an “active Shooter at the Capital Gazette building in Ann Arundel County. The paper is owned by The Baltimore Sun newspaper chain.
Aerial photos of the complex show a large police presence and people being led out of the building with their hands in the air. Local media also say medical helicopters have been sent to the scene.
